The cities of Gotham and Riverdale collide this fall when DC Comics and Archie Comics bring together two high-profile female duos in the six-issue crossover Harley & Ivy Meet Betty & Veronica.

RELATED: Batman and Harley Animated Film is Getting a Prequel Comic

Harley Quinn co-creator Paul Dini will collaborate with writer Marc Andreyko and artist Laura Braga on the miniseries, which sees the fan-favorite antiheroine and her pal Poison Ivy team up against Betty Cooper and and Veronica Lodge when a new proposal looks to drain the wetlands between Gotham and Riverdale. The nature lover that she is, Ivy comes up with the idea to kidnap Riverdale's resident heiress Veronica and her best friend Betty.

“It’s the sort of offer you scream out ‘YES!’ to before your eyes reach the middle of the email,” Dini said in a statement to Entertainment Weekly. “I’ve always wanted the chance to play in Riverdale and to help Harley and Ivy invade it is a dream come true. Marc’s a great talent and a good friend. Writing this series with him has been like sitting on the lawn during summer vacation and reading a big pile of DC and Archie comics. Except we have to stay indoors and type a lot.”

Amanda Conners, who co-writes DC's Harley Quinn, will provide the covers for Harley & Ivy Meet Betty & Veronica, with Betty & Veronica's Adam Hughes providing variant covers. Conners' cover for Issue 1 is below.

Harley & Ivy Meet Betty & Veronica #1 goes on sale Oct. 4.
